Germany Drops Plan to Extend Pledge/Loan Term for Tax-Free Cryptocurrency Sales to 10 Years

Presight Capital crypto venture advisor Patrick Hansen tweeted that German MP Frank Schäffler was organizing a crypto tax roundtable at the German Parliament yesterday. The good news is that pledging/lending of crypto assets will no longer extend the holding period for tax-free sales (usually 1 year) to 10 years.
